Cambridgeshire borders Lincolnshire to the north, Norfolk to the northeast, Suffolk to the east, Essex and Hertfordshire to the south, and Bedfordshire and Northamptonshire to the west.
Cambridgeshire is a very horse friendly English county.
It is one of the most central counties for equestrian events and horse riding in England, and has excellent road access making it easy for horseboxes and trailers to get to.
Equestrian facilities such as the Sedgeway Equestrian Centre and the SCEC make horse riding in Cambridgeshire easily accessible.
Friendly local riding schools and an abundance of competitively priced livery yards make owning a horse in Cambridgeshire relatively inexpensive.
Horse Riding & Equestrian Facilities in Cambridgeshire.

Bridge Farm Riding School – 01954 252284
Smithy Fen, Cottenham, Cambridge, CB24 8PT
Bridge Farm is a friendly riding school in Cottenham, located about 6 miles north of Cambridge. We offer riding for children and adults, from beginners to advanced, in groups or privately. Our pony days are held during school holidays and are enjoyed by riders, horses and ponies alike.

South Cambridgeshire Equestrian Centre – 01763 263213
Foxton Rd, Barrington, Cambridgeshire, England
The SCEC is an approved ABRS and accredited Pony Club offering you lessons and clinics for all abilities from beginners to those wishing to improve their horsemanship skills. Nestling in 260 acres of South Cambridgeshire countryside we offer a range of services for all your equestrian needs.

Sedgeway Equestrian Centre – 01353 654100
Sedgeway Business Park, Witchford, Ely, Cambridgeshire, CB6 2HY
A British Horse Society Approved Riding School & Livery Yard providing riding lessons and hosting equestrian events. The centre has 40 acres of safe, well fenced pasture land and we are also an approved Training Centre affiliated to The College Of West Anglia …
